Master Nick Nixon

Master Nick Nixon
Master
Nick Nixon began studying International Kajukenbo in 1988 and is
currently a Godan. He is a musician/songwriter. He plays the drums and
guitar. In 1983 he had a internationally acclaimed album, Still Life,
with Alan Ginsberg. From 1985-90 he was owner/CEO of ABC Bail Bonds,
which he built to be Colorado?s largest bonding company. He was
owner/CEO/Publisher of Amazing Sports Publication from 1989-93. In 1990
he was inducted into the New Orleans Saints Hall of Fame. From 1993-94
he was a Sales Coordinator for Neoplan USA Corporation and a host of a 1
hour per week radio show, KQXI "Collector's Corner". From 1993-96 he was
an extra on several Perry Mason movies and 1 Dick Van Dyke movie as well
as a model for JF Images. He was Executive Director of Sales & Marketing
for Gas-O-Haul from 1994-95. In 2002 he received CCMA Band of the Year
and a CCMS 2nd place finish in songwriting. He is currently owner/CEO of
High Level International (marketing & consulting firm), owner/CEO of
Nick Nixon Real Estate and Director of Marketing for Advanced Concrete
Innovations. He belonged to the following organizations: Colorado
Professional Bail Bonding Association (1985-90), Colorado Press
Association(1990-93), Automotive Parts & Accessories Association
(1994-99), Prowers County Historical Society (VP/1997-99) and
(Pres/1999-01). He has had publications in "I Collect Magazine", "CU"(world's
1st scented comic book), "UNLV"(1st college sports comic book), "The New
Orleans Saints", and "The Denver Broncos"world's 1st team sports comic
book).
